Rick Thomas wrote: Every time I create a new document in LibreOffice Writer it wants to print on A4 paper. I have Squeeze with OpenOffice ATM, and the usual way to set the paper size permanently is running /usr/lib/openoffice/program/spadmin as user, select your printer and click 'Properties'.
